Factors Affecting Cost
- Extent of Damage: Larger or more severe potholes will generally cost more to repair due to the increased amount of materials and labor required.
- Materials Used: Different materials such as asphalt or concrete have varying costs, impacting the overall repair expense.
- Labor Costs: The cost of labor can vary depending on the contractor and the complexity of the job.
- Location: Accessibility of the site can influence the cost, with more difficult-to-reach areas potentially requiring additional equipment or time.
- Weather Conditions: Adverse weather can delay repairs and increase costs due to the need for additional labor or materials to ensure proper installation.
- Urgency of Repair: Emergency repairs or expedited services often come with a premium price.
Average Costs for Common Tasks
Task | Average Cost (Portland, ME) |
---|---|
Small Pothole Repair | $100 - $300 |
Medium Pothole Repair | $300 - $600 |
Large Pothole Repair | $600 - $1,200 |
Full Asphalt Overlay | $2,000 - $5,000 per 1,000 sq ft |
Crack Sealing | $1 - $3 per linear foot |
Sealcoating | $0.15 - $0.30 per sq ft |
